Reps: 3,101,825,598,494,030 (power: 3,101,825,598,497) | | Originally Posted by drich0150 Well in the U.S. they did out law all automatic weapons before a certain year. and even so, you have to have a law enforcement back Ground or a class III dealers license to have one. And also you have to have a Curio/Relic license to transfer or take possession of any fire arms across state lines, plus you have to have a conceal/carry permit to even carry a gun on your person in public...
I say all of this to say, the best, or closest thing the government will be able to do is add more restrictions to the already strenuous laws.. If they choose to do this then I'll have to file more paper work, and go through more background checks, and pay more "fees" To do what i like doing in my spare time..
If they do actually pass a Bill that disarms America then I guess I'll buy dummy receivers (the Gun frame which everything is attached to) and continue to display and collect.. (this is what people do when they have an Automatic weapons that they are not supposed to have.. 90% of the Gun is real and ready to fire, but the piece that everything is bolted to won't allow bullets to be chambered.) So the gun is inert. But in a since still very real, and in my case so is the history.
